Coursera
Coursera is a well-known online learning platform that collaborates with top universities and
organizations worldwide to offer a wide range of courses, including technology-related
subjects.

  • Course Type: Coursera offers courses in various tech fields such as programming, data science, artificial intelligence, cloud computing, and more.
  • Course Levels: Courses on Coursera are available at beginner, intermediate, and
    advanced levels, catering to learners with varying degrees of expertise.
  • Course Areas: The platform covers diverse areas within the tech domain, including
    programming languages (Python, Java, etc.), data analysis and visualization,
    machine learning, cybersecurity, and more.
  • Pricing Model: Coursera operates on a freemium model, where learners can audit
    courses for free but need to pay for certification or access to graded assignments.
  • Features: Coursera provides high-quality content developed by industry experts and
    university professors, a flexible learning experience with a mix of video lectures, quizzes, assignments, and peer-reviewed projects, and the option to earn certificates
    from reputed institutions upon course completion.

edX

edX is a leading online learning platform offering courses from universities, colleges, and organizations worldwide, including prestigious institutions like MIT and Harvard.

  • Course Type: edX covers a broad range of tech-related topics, including computer
    science, cybersecurity, data analysis, software development, and more.
  • Course Levels: Courses on edX are available at various levels, from introductory to
    advanced, catering to learners with different skill levels and backgrounds.
  • Course Areas: The platform covers diverse areas within the tech domain, such as
    programming languages, data science and analytics,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, and software engineering.
  • Pricing Model: edX offers a mix of free and paid courses. Learners can audit courses for free, but they need to pay for certificates or access to graded assignments.
  • Features: edX provides high-quality course materials, interactive exercises, virtual
    labs, instructor-led discussions, and verified certificates for completing courses,
    enhancing learners; resumes and professional credentials.

Udacity

Udacity is renowned for its focus on skill-based learning and industry-relevant courses,
particularly in the fields of programming and technology.

  • Course Type: Udacity offers nanodegree programs in areas such as data science,
    artificial intelligence, programming, cloud computing, and more.
  • Course Levels: Nanodegree programs on Udacity are structured to provide in-depth
    knowledge and practical skills, suitable for learners at different proficiency levels.
  • Course Areas: Udacity's nanodegree programs cover a broad spectrum of tech-
    related topics, including front-end and back-end web development, mobile app development, machine learning, and autonomous systems.
  • Pricing Model: Udacity operates on a subscription-based model, where learners pay
    a monthly subscription fee for access to nanodegree programs and related services.
  • Features: Udacity’s features include hands-on projects, personalized feedback from
    mentors, career services, access to a global network of industry professionals, and
    courses designed in collaboration with tech giants like Google, IBM, and AWS.
